German GP: Leclerc fastest in second practice, Gasly crashes

Scuderia Ferrari carried its promising German Grand Prix Free Practice 1 form into the day's second session, but the positions were reversed with Charles Leclerc leading Sebastian Vettel. Vettel was fastest in the morning at Hockenheim, but Leclerc responded on a very hot afternoon by edging ahead of his team-mate by 0.124 seconds with a lap time of 1:13.449. Mercedes AMG Motorsport‘s Lewis Hamilton and Valtteri Bottas trailed the Ferraris, although Hamilton was much closer to Leclerc's time and over 0.5s ahead of Bottas.
